Texas 2025 - 89th Regular

Texas House Bill HR1341

Caption

Congratulating the members of the Judson Early College Academy Class of 2025 on their achievements.

Impact

The resolution not only celebrates the individual achievements of the students but also recognizes the value of their education at the Judson Early College Academy since its inception in 2009. The resolution emphasizes the significant milestone of this class being the first to all graduate with associate's degrees with distinguished honors from Northeast Lakeview College. Such recognitions reflect positively on the educational institution and the support provided by educators and staff, challenging others to reach similar heights.

Summary

House Resolution 1341 (HR1341) serves to congratulate the members of the Judson Early College Academy Class of 2025 for their outstanding academic achievements, particularly their participation in the College Signing Day Celebration. This event allows seniors to publicly acknowledge their college acceptances and scholarship offers. Notably, the Class of 2025 garnered nearly 800 scholarship offers and more than 1,100 college and university acceptances, which highlights their academic diligence and success in the program.
